Currently he is the editor-in-chief for International Journal of Emerging Technologies in Sciences and Engineering (IJETSE), Canada. He has been a program committee member for about 40 international conferences such as IEEE TrustCom, IEEE ICCIT, IEEE/ACIS, IEEE ICARCV and IEEE AINA. Ali has chaired many conferences including DMAI, NSS, ICDKE and ISDA. Currently he is editing another book on Application of Computational Intelligence. His Data Mining book is being used as text in more than two dozen of universities around the Globe. He has also published several book chapters and books. He has published more than 112 research papers in international journals and conferences, most of them are IEEE/ELSEVIER journals/conferences, such as IEEE Transactions on Intelligent Transportation Systems, WSEAS Transactions on Information Science and Applications, Journal of Medical Systems, Springer, Renewable Energy, ELSEVIER. In particular, he is currently leading in a research group on Computational Intelligence. His research interests include Computational Intelligence, Data Mining, Smart Grid, Cloud Computing and Biomedical Engineering. He received his PhD in Information Technology from Clayton School of Information Technology, Monash University. Ali is currently with School of Engineering and Technology, CQUniversity, Australia. A Smart Grid delivers renewable energy as a main source of electricity from producers to consumers using two-way monitoring through Smart Meter technology that can remotely control consumer electricity use.
